Why OLED and AMOLED Displays Matter for Runners
OLED and AMOLED screens offer superior image quality with deep blacks and bright colors. For runners, this means clearer data visualization, easier readability in bright sunlight, and a more engaging user experience. Additionally, these displays tend to be more power-efficient, extending battery life during long runs.

Choosing the Right Watch for You
When selecting a running watch with an OLED or AMOLED display, consider factors such as screen size, battery life, additional health metrics, and compatibility with your smartphone. The best device should enhance your running experience without adding unnecessary bulk.
Key Features to Look For
- Display Quality: Brightness, contrast, and resolution.
- Battery Life: How long the watch lasts on a single charge.
- Health Monitoring: Heart rate, SpO2, sleep tracking.
- GPS Accuracy: Precise location tracking for outdoor runs.
- Durability: Water resistance and ruggedness for outdoor use.
